Details of all-metal light biplane which can be built in two models as simple cheap model with no slots, non-steering tail skid and simple rubber-cord undercarriage, or as better-class job with slots, steering tail skid, high-class undercarriage, and other refinements; engine fitted is 33 to 36-hp. Bristol Cherub III; top speed 96 m.p.h.; landing speed 40 m.p.h.; fuselage front of box construction of duralumin plate stiffened with duralumin angles.
Another cheap single-seater design, "The beetle,"
